 Loosen and remove flange nut from spindle. Do not
remove disc flange.
 Make sure flats on the bottom of disc flange are engaged
with flats on spindle.
 Place the grinding wheel over the spindle.
WARNING:
Always install a grinding wheel with the depressed center
against the disc flange. Failure to do so will cause the
grinding wheel to crack when tightening the flange nut.
This could result in serious personal injury because of
loose particles breaking off and being thrown from the
grinder. Do not overtighten.
 Thread the flange nut on the spindle with the flat side of nut
facing up. Fit raised, small diameter portion of the clamp
nut into the hole in the wheel and finger tighten.
 Depress and hold the spindle lock button and rotate the
wheel clockwise until the spindle locks in position.
 Securely tighten the nut with the wrench provided.
Do not overtighten.

APPLICATIONS
You may use this tool for the purposes listed below:
 Grinding metals
 Sanding wood or metal surfaces (sanding disc and pad
not included)
 Polishing and buffing (pad and bonnet not included)
ASSEMBLY
DANGER:
Never attach a TYPE 1 straight or cut-off wheel to this
angle grinder. It is only designed for grinding and sand-
ing. Use for any other purpose is not recommended and
creates a hazard, which will result in serious injury.
INSTALLING THE SIDE HANDLE
See Figure 2, page 12.
WARNING:
The side handle must always be used to help prevent
loss of control and possible serious injury.
 Unplug the angle grinder.
 Insert the side handle into the desired operating
position.
 Securely tighten by turning the side handle clockwise.
NOTE: You can install the handle on the top, left, or right side
of the grinder depending on operator preference.

OPERATION

SWITCH TRIGGER
See Figure 3, page 12.
To turn the tool ON, depress the lock-off/lock-on button,
then depress the switch trigger. To turn it OFF, release the
switch trigger.
LOCK-OFF/LOCK-ON BUTTON
See Figure 3, page 12.
The lock-off/lock-on button prevents accidental starting of the
grinder, and also allows the grinder to be locked-on, which
is convenient for continuous grinding/sanding/polishing for
extended periods of time.
To lock-on:
 Hold the grinder in front and away from you with both
hands, keeping the grinding wheel clear of the workpiece.
 Push in and hold the lock-off/lock-on button, located on
the side of the handle.
 Depress the switch trigger.
 Push in further on the lock-off/lock-on button.
 Release the switch trigger.
 Release the lock-on button and the tool will continue
running.
 To release the lock, depress and release the switch
trigger.
